4 The previous set of octuplets were born in 1998 in Houston,Texas.
Girl A, weighed 690g (22 oz.) at birth Girl B, weighed 760g (24.4 oz.) at birth Girl C, weighed 800g (25.7 oz.) at birth Girl D, weighed 730g (23.5 oz.) at birth Girl E, weighed 320g (10.3 oz.) at birth Boy F, weighed 500g (16.0 oz.) at birth Boy G, weighed 810g (26.0 oz.) at birth Girl H, weighed 520g (16.7 oz.) at birth So the heaviest baby was 810g. 7 Up2d8 maths Octuplets Teacher Notes

8 Octuplets Introduction: A woman in America has recently given birth to eight babies. This resource will give you the opportunity to explore issues related to the costs of living with multiple births and interpret information about sizes and weights in the context of the previous octuplet birth in America. NB: It will be important to be aware of the emotional issues surrounding this topic and not to treat it solely as a numerical exercise. Content objectives: - use proportional reasoning to solve problems - use units of measurement to measure, estimate, calculate and solve problems in a range of contexts - interpret tables, graphs and diagrams for discrete and continuous data, relating summary statistics and findings to the questions being explored. 9 Activity: First, students are given the opportunity to consider the pros and cons of living with eight babies at the same time and, from this, to think about some possible benefits and issues, possible solutions and costs. Secondly, students are invited to consider the sizes of the babies at birth. Can they imagine or demonstrate how heavy the babies were? Can they find out how tall (or long) the babies were?. Differentiation: You may decide to change the level of challenge for your group. To make the task easier you could consider: asking students to investigate only one of the tasks asking students to investigate only one of the issues they have identified using the website to make some weight comparisons providing a writing frame to assist in writing up the enquiry. To make the task more complex you could consider: removing the weights in kg or ounces and ask pupils to calculate some conversion facts using the weight statistics to calculate some measures of average and spread to compare with a known pair of twins, triplets etc. asking the students to design their own task related to the context. This resource is designed to be adapted to your requirements. Outcomes: You may want to consider what the outcome of the task will be and share this with students according to their ability. This could be: designing a gift list for a ‘baby shower’ with or without costs designing a monthly budget sheet for the family expenses a poster highlighting the changes the family has made in their lifestyle writing an entry for a ‘baby book’ for one of the octuplets a poster putting the weights/heights of the octuplets into context. Probing questions: Initially students could brainstorm issues to consider. You may wish to introduce some points into the discussion which might include: Task 1 Think about some of the joys of having eight babies. What would be good for the parents? What would be difficult for the parents? What would be difficult for the children? What would you do if all the babies were crying at once? Could you care for all eight on your own? How would you go out? How often would you have to do the washing? How many nappies would you need per day? Per week? Per month? Task 2 Has a student in the class had a new birth in the family? Do they know the weight of that baby? Can they identify something that has a similar weight? Why might these babies be smaller? What else do you have that weighs about 810g? Would a baby weighing 810g be bigger or smaller in size than that?
